The Shattered Alarm introduces readers to Marty Watts, a fledgling detective at the Hertz County Police Department. Marty, alongside the seasoned detective Sherman Hoakes, is thrust into a high-stakes investigation involving a potential cyber-attack at Netmore, an electronics manufacturer. However, the plot thickens when a local resident mysteriously vanishes, leaving Marty with the daunting task of solving both cases within a single day.

Joe Turcotte’s The Shattered Alarm is a gripping start to the Detective Watts Series, blending elements of mystery and thriller with a touch of procedural drama. The narrative is fast-paced, keeping readers on the edge of their seats as Marty navigates the complexities of his dual investigations.

The plot is intricately woven, with multiple threads that converge in a satisfying climax. Turcotte masterfully balances the tension between the corporate intrigue at Netmore and the personal stakes of the missing resident. The pacing is relentless, with each chapter ending on a cliffhanger that propels the story forward.

Marty Watts is a compelling and likeable protagonist. His journey from an eager apprentice to a confident detective is well-portrayed, making him relatable and endearing.

Sherman Hoakes, the veteran detective, provides a perfect foil to Marty’s youthful enthusiasm, offering wisdom and experience. The supporting characters are well-drawn, each adding depth to the narrative.

Turcotte’s writing is crisp and engaging. He excels in creating vivid scenes and building suspense. The dialogue is sharp and realistic, enhancing the authenticity of the characters and their interactions. The alternating perspectives provide a comprehensive view of the unfolding events, adding layers to the mystery.

The novel explores themes of trust, perseverance, and the blurred lines between friends and foes. Marty’s determination to prove himself and his ability to think on his feet are central to the story, highlighting the importance of resilience in the face of adversity.

The Shattered Alarm is a promising debut for the Detective Watts Series. Joe Turcotte has crafted a thrilling mystery that keeps readers guessing until the very end. With its well-developed characters, intricate plot, and engaging writing, this book is a must-read for fans of the genre. I eagerly await the next installment in the series.
